About the position
We are currently recruiting confident and reliable individuals to work as Cover Supervisors. In this role, you will be responsible for delivering pre-prepared lessons, managing classroom behaviour, and maintaining a positive learning environment in the absence of the regular classroom teacher.

✨Tip Number 1
Network with current or former Cover Supervisors in the Harrogate area. They can provide insights into their experiences and may even refer you to opportunities within their schools.
✨Tip Number 2
Familiarise yourself with the curriculum and common classroom management strategies. This knowledge will help you feel more confident during interviews and when stepping into a classroom.
✨Tip Number 3
Attend local education job fairs or workshops. These events are great for meeting potential employers and learning more about what they look for in a Cover Supervisor.
✨Tip Number 4
Consider volunteering or shadowing in schools to gain hands-on experience. This not only enhances your CV but also demonstrates your commitment to working in education.
